About the Mazda 2

The Mazda 2 is the driver's choice among the small hatchbacks and the best-finished cabin at this price in our fleet. Unlike most rivals it uses a conventional six-speed torque-converter automatic rather than a CVT, which makes it feel more responsive and less droning on hill climbs. The interior materials, the seats and the driving position are a clear step above the Yaris and the Swift.

Who the Mazda 2 suits

Couples who want the cheapest bracket of car without the cheapest-feeling cabin, and anyone who actually enjoys driving. It carries the same two large cases as the other hatchbacks - you are paying for quality, not space.

The Mazda 2 on Koh Samui roads

The real six-speed automatic is the thing to know about here. On Samui's short, steep climbs a CVT tends to hold high revs and sound strained; the Mazda's conventional gearbox simply changes down and gets on with it. Combined with the sharpest steering of any small car we rent, it makes the interior roads and the switchbacks up to the viewpoints genuinely enjoyable rather than merely survivable.

Mazda 2 rental - frequently asked questions

Why does the Mazda 2 cost more than a Toyota Yaris?

Better interior, more standard equipment including Apple CarPlay and leather, and a conventional six-speed automatic instead of a CVT. Space and running costs are much the same - you are paying for how it feels, not what it carries.

Is the Mazda 2 a hatchback or a sedan?

We rent the five-door hatchback. Mazda sells a sedan version in Thailand too; if you specifically need a separate locked boot, tell us at booking and we will confirm availability.

Is the Mazda 2 economical on fuel?

Yes, around 5 litres per 100 km in island driving, essentially identical to the Yaris and Swift. The six-speed automatic is if anything slightly better on the open ring road than a CVT.
